An urgent warning was issued for NATO countries. Russia is preparing a powerful cyber attack
As reported in mid -April, the minister of digitization Krzysztof Gawkowski, The number of attacks on the Polish cyberspace in 2024 increased by 64 percent, and recently there was a disturbing severity of the actions of Russian services. In the face of this data, information about the cybernetic campaign sponsored by Russia is particularly disturbing.
A warning in this matter on Wednesday, May 21 was published by Great Britain together with allies, including: Polish, USA, Germany, the Czech Republic, Australia, Canada, Denmark, Estonia, France and the Netherlands. As emphasized, entities threatened with these cyber attacks should take immediate protective actions.
This malicious campaign of Russian military intelligence is a serious threat to organizations, including those involved in providing help from Ukraine
– warned Paul Chichester, operational director of the British National Cybersecurity Center (NCSC) cited by the Reuters agency.
According to experts, hackers will also be directed against the defense, sea, air, port and air traffic management sectors in NATO Member States. In the face of the escalation of cyber attacks, these entities must be ready for quick response.
« We definitely encourage organizations to familiarize themselves with the threats and advice on their alleviating, which were included in the warning to help them defend their networks, » pointed out Paul Chichester.
